If you want to take your motion design skills to the next level, learning how to create interactive motion graphics is a must.
Interactive motion graphics are animations that respond to user input, making them engaging and memorable.
This skill is perfect for designers who want to create engaging content for websites, apps, and social media platforms.
Let’s say you’re creating a website for a restaurant and you want to create an interactive menu.
You could create an animation that allows users to click on different menu items to see more information about them.
The animation could also include a feature that allows users to add items to their order and submit it directly through the website.
Another example could be creating an interactive infographic for a healthcare company.
The animation could allow users to hover over different parts of the infographic to see more information about specific topics.
The animation could also include interactive quizzes to test the user’s knowledge.
